Спиральная модель (Боэм) оказалась чрезвычайно популярной. Суть ее состоит в том, что вместо действий с обратной связью происходит выполнение различных этапов по спирали. Каждый виток спирали соответствует 1 итерации. Заранее фиксированных фаз нет, их состав зависит от потребностей.
Каждый виток разбит на 4 сектора: определение целей, оценка и разрешение рисков, планирование, разработка и тестирование.
На каждом витке спирали могут применяться разные модели процесса разработки ПО. В конечном итоге на выходе получается готовый продукт.
Главное отличие от других моделей состоит в акценте на анализ и преодоление рисков (об этом мы еще будем говорить более подробно в 3 разделе нашего курса).
Что дальше?
Тема следующей лекции – Визуальное моделирование при анализе и проектировании.
Основы Unified Modeling Language (UML).
Литература
1. Ian Sommerville. Software Engineering. 6th Edition.
https://www.comp.lancs.ac.uk/computing/resources/IanS/SE6
2. Ian Sommerville. Software Engineering. 7th Edition.
https://www.comp.lancs.ac.uk/computing/resources/IanS/SE7
3. Иан Соммервиль. Инженерия программного обеспечения. 6 изд, и.д. "Вильямс", 2002. — 624 с.
4. Э. Салливан. Время – деньги. – М.:Microsoft Press, Русская редакция, 2002.
5. Большая Советская Энциклопедия.